Product Description

· Feature-Rich, Wire-Free Security - The C425 camera addresses common security camera challenges with its easy installation and maintenance. It offers a range of features designed to simplify monitoring and enhance security. · Wire-Free & Versatile Installation - This IP66 weatherproof camera offers hassle-free, wire-free mounting. Its magnetic base enables easy attachment to metal surfaces, providing flexible indoor and outdoor placement. · Extended Battery Life - The 10000mAh battery offers up to 300 days of use. For continuous power, use the optional Tapo A200 Solar Panel (sold separately), which eliminates the need for recharging.together. · 2K QHD with 150° FOV - The 2K QHD resolution provides clear details like license plates, offering 1.7x the pixels of 1080p. The 150° field of view covers a larger area for broader monitoring. · Full-Color Night Vision - Capture vibrant, full-color images at night with the integrated Starlight sensor and built-in spotlights. · Secure Local & Cloud Storage - Store footage on up to a 512GB microSD card (sold separately) or subscribe to the Tapo Care for cloud storage, which offers 30 days of video history. WillarReviewed in the United States on December 19, 2024

I wanted this camera to install at our front door to watch the front porch, sidewalk and driveway without having to run power wire to the placement. I had this camera up and running very quickly, connected to my wifi and the Tapo app, and the mount installed near the front door with one screw inside 1 hour. We've had it up for a little over a month and it's working great for us. Both the wife and I have the app on our phones and ipads, and we both have set it for alerts when there is "motion" or a "person" detected. There is also a setting for "pet alert" but the motion works for alerting that our dogs are at the door. The picture is very clear, day or night, and the memory (with our own memory card added) works well so we can see who/want has been at our door or sidewalk. I did block out the street so we don't get an alert for every car that drive by. We've had it up about a month and use it a lot and the battery is at 71% so I'd guess we'll need to take it in to charge about every 3 months, but we use our front door a lot and view it a lot so we are draining the battery quicker than if it was used less. In the spring I will add another to our back porch so we can watch the dogs out back and anyone on our back patio. Highly recommended! I won't hesitate to recommend this camera to friends.

ShadReviewed in the United States on October 21, 2024

Camera setup was easy and has some nice features like an option to use WiFi or Ethernet, geofencing, being able to alert you to specific occurrences such as a car detected, person detected, animal detected, and if someone crosses a defined area or line. It has an alarm, although not very loud but enough to let someone near it know they’re being recorded. There are also 2 LED lights for recording, but it’s not something that will light up anything (like the ground), even when set to 100% brightness, but is intended to enhance the video quality. I turned it off so it’s not obvious when it detects motion and is actively recording. You can also turn off the LED status light so it doesn’t call attention to it as much. The thing I don’t like is that the inside of the lens sometimes “fogs up”, even when mounted indoors, making it impossible to identify anything. It tends to clear up if I turn the camera off for a few minutes. Other times, in daylight when the lens isn’t foggy, the video isn’t bad. I have concerns it will get extra foggy should it be humid, cold, or raining. Overall it has nice features, but poor video (or perhaps this one is defective). I set the video resolution to the max of 2K and also tried HDR mode for increased clarity, so this was as good as it gets. Even at that, after dark with outside lights on, it’s impossible to identify someone 7’ below where the camera is mounted. UPDATE: The video has been clear after that first day or so. I’m thinking some moisture had gotten in and it just had to burn off in the sun. I added another photo of someone about 25’ out with a leaf blower, and the quality is pretty good. I would definitely recommend.

Steve in British Columbia, CanadaReviewed in Canada on August 22, 2024

I came here to buy this after it was ranked first in a New York Times review of security cameras. Not only did it finish first it was also the cheapest. This camera replaces a previous cheap model that has since disappeared from Amazon. That experience was maddening. Flakey and limited software, intermittent WIFI signal, constant false notifications. This camera is mounted in the same spot and connected to the WIFI instantly. The software is simple and intuitive to use. The speaker is a little poor quality but I'm using it as driveway surveillance and have no plans on using the speaker. The image is very clear and downloads are simple and flawless. I have yet to figure out how to delete files on the SD card but with a 64 GB card I had kicking around and installed, I really don't need to worry about. The Activity and Privacy Zones (areas to watch and areas to ignore) work great. I'm able to cut out the front street traffic and identify only movement in the yard and driveway. The microphone is very sensitive. What a wonderful package for such a good price. I'll likely buy a couple of their solar units for mounting high on trees to watch all my good neighbours out walking their dogs...and the rare punk looking for Ford pickups to steal. One quick picky thing for the manufacturer. Please don't tighten the screws to the SD card door so tight. It was a struggle to remove even with the perfect sized Phillips screwdriver. Other than that, great product!
